Staying at the Tabard Inn is truly a one-of-a-kind experience. This historic gem is full of character, charm, and personality—you can feel the history the moment you walk through the door. I absolutely loved the eclectic art throughout the property. Every corner feels thoughtfully curated, making it as much an experience as it is a place to stay. It’s warm, inviting, and refreshingly different from typical hotels. It’s important to note—this is not your standard modern hotel. There’s no central air or heat, and no elevator, but honestly, that’s part of the charm. If you appreciate unique, historic spaces, you’ll find it adds to the authenticity rather than detracts from it. And the bulldogs? An unexpected and delightful touch that made the stay even more memorable. The breakfast is simply amazing—fresh, delicious, and the perfect way to start your day in DC. If you’re looking for something unique, cozy, and full of personality, the Tabard Inn is an absolute treat.

About Tabard Inn

Tabard Inn Location
Located in Washington (Downtown Washington D.C.), Tabard Inn is within a 15-minute walk of Smithsonian Institution and George Washington University. This hotel is 1 mi (1.6 km) from White House and 1.1 mi (1.8 km) from Walter E. Washington Convention Center.

Tabard Inn Facility and Service
Take in the views from a terrace and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access and a fireplace in the lobby.

Tabard Inn Rooms
Make yourself at home in one of the 35 individually decorated guestrooms. Complimentary wireless internet access is available to keep you connected. Bathrooms have compl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include desks and complimentary bottled water, and housekeeping is provided daily.

Restaurant and Cafe
Enjoy a satisfying meal at Tabard Inn Restaurant serving guests of Tabard Inn. Wrap up your day with a drink at the bar/lounge. Cooked-to-order breakfasts are served on weekdays from 8:00 AM to 10:00 AM for a fee.
